The seven worst years for polar ice sheets melting and losing ice have occurred during the past decade, according to new research, with 2019 being the worst year on record. The melting ice sheets now account for a quarter of all sea level rise -- a fivefold increase since the 1990's -- according to researchers who have combined 50 satellite surveys of Antarctica and Greenland taken between 1992 and 2020, funded by NASA and the European Space Agency.

Small interfering RNAs (siRNAs) are novel therapeutics that can be used to treat a wide range of diseases. This has led to a growing demand for selective, efficient, and safe ways of delivering siRNA in cells. Now, in a cooperation between the Universities of Amsterdam and Leiden, researchers have developed dedicated molecular nanocages for siRNA delivery. In a paper just out in the Journal Chem they present nanocages that are easy to prepare and display tuneable siRNA delivery characteristics.

CLIMATE According to the climate plans submitted to the UN by 50 countries, 12 gigatons of CO2 per year will continue to be emitted by 2050 -- and need to be removed from the atmosphere. Among other things, countries are betting on technology and nature restoration to solve the problem of residual emissions. Researchers describe this as worrying. The researchers recommend rapid reductions here and now.

Plants that glow under ultraviolet (UV) light aren't only a figment of science fiction TV and movies. Roots of a traditional medicine plant called the orange climber, or Toddalia asiatica, can fluoresce an ethereal blue hue. And now, researchers have identified two coumarin molecules that could be responsible. These natural coumarins have unique fluorescent properties, and one of the compounds could someday be used for medical imaging.
